Report on Household Consumption and Expenditure Survey 2010/11 (2002 E.C)

 

The core objective of the HCE survey is to provide data that enable to understand the income dimension of poverty and the major objectives are to:

  • Assess the level, extent and distribution of income dimension of poverty;
  • Provide data on the levels, distribution and pattern of household expenditure that will be used for analysis of changes in the households' living standard level over time in various socio-economic groups and geographical areas;
  • Provide basic data that enables to design, monitor and evaluate the impact of socio- economic policies and programs on households/individuals living standard;
  • Furnish series of data for assessing poverty situations, in general, and food security, in particular;
  • Provide data for compiling household accounts in the system of national accounts, especially in the estimation of private consumption expenditure; and
